Volunteer opportunities to support Unitarian Universalism
SCORE, the Southern Cluster Outreach and Extension Ministry, is seeking volunteers. SCORE represents small congregation in our region, the Prairie Star District, to support growth of Unitarian Universalism where we live. SCORE pays the salary of an extension minister, and helps emerging congregations so they can be recognized as fellowships. This is the only program like it in the country and it serves as a prototype. To be a part of this exciting work, contact SUUF.
